JACKSONVILLE, Fla. -
Brad Deppermann's 2019 has been stellar and in Saturday's 9-1 win against Florida A&M (18-26) it became historic as the righty became the new career-strikeout king in UNF's Division I record books.
Deppermann fanned nine all-told, giving him 214 for his career and pushing him past
Kyle Westwood (2010-13) who had the previous record at 210.

Behind the Line Score
- UNF (24-17) took a 1-0 lead in the second. Wes Weeks legged out an infield single, swiped second and Alex Reynolds walked. David Maberry recorded a productive out, moving both up 90 feet. Abraham Sequera plated Weeks with an RBI groundout.
- Chris Berry flew out to deep-right field in the first but in the third he hit one even better, blasting a solo shot to straight away right for a 2-0 lead.
- The lead expanded in the fourth. Maberry chopped a single up the middle and took second on a beautiful bunt single from Abraham Sequera. Blake Marabell walked to load the bags before Berry scored Maberry on an RBI groundout. Jay Prather hit a ringing RBI single to right, scoring Sequera and pushing FAMU starter Kyle Coleman from the game.
- FAMU broke up Deppermann's no-no and the shutout in the fifth. Kaycee Reese singled through the left side and moved to third on a double inside the third base bag off the bat of Seyjuan Lawrence. Brett Maxwell scored Reese one batter with a sacrifice fly to right on a lineout to Weeks.
- UNF scored four in the fifth, expanding the lead to 8-1. Alex Reynolds singled up the middle and took second on a wild pitch. Maberry walked and Sequera rolled an RBI single to right, allowing Reynolds to slide just under the tag of FAMU's Maxwell at home. Marabell mashed a three-run home run that landed on the batting cage roof in left to complete the scoring in the frame.
- Zach Chappell came into the game in the seventh, worked a one-two-three inning and wiggled out of a tense eighth, stranding the bags loaded.
- UNF made it 9-1 in the eighth. Weeks doubled to left and Reynolds plated him one batter later with a single to right.
- Logan Clayton allowed a leadoff double in the ninth but powered through with a pair of strikeouts and a groundout.

Notes
- Deppermann held a perfect game through three innings and took a no-hitter into the fifth.
- This is UNF's 16th game in double figures for hits.
- The Ospreys are 15-0 against FAMU at home and 23-2 in series history.
- Prather has 20 multi-hit performances this year.
- The Ospreys are 19-9 at home this season.
- UNF is 11-5 against in-state foes.
- Deppermann has 82 strikeouts this year, fourth most punchouts by a pitcher in a single season during the program's Division I history.
- Deppermann has twirled 11 starts of at least 5.0 innings. He's done so in 10 consecutive starts.
- Weeks had 14 stolen bases, tied for the league lead.
